On the NOVA processing scale, Air fried fish fillets is classified as Group 4 (Ultra-processed). NOVA measures industrial processing intensity rather than ingredient-level safety, so it complements the SAFFA and CSPI ratings: a product can be clean on additive flags but heavily processed, or lightly processed but carry individually flagged ingredients. Combining both lenses gives a fuller picture than either alone.

Full Ingredient List

2538 learn more at gortons.com/sustainability ko 1371 ton's 180z crunchy breaded fish fillets ingredients: alaska pollock fillets, breadcrumb coating. alaska pollock fillets breadcrumb coating bleached wheat flour, water, wheat flour, palm oil, modified corn starch, maltodextrin, dehydrated onion, yeast, caramel color, citric acid, brewers yeast, baking powder (baking soda, sodium aluminum phosphate), paprika extract (color), natural flavor, dehydrated garlic, dehydrated green bell pepper, xanthan gum, malic acid, colored with annatto and turmeric extract. contains: pollock, wheat, milk. produced on same equipment used for shrimp and other fish species. tn find recipes & special offers on gortons.com or facebook.com/gortonsseafood gloucester, ma 01930 coating contains bioengineered food ingredients. although great care is taken to remove bones, some may remain. ©2021 gorton's inc. gorton's and related designs are trademarks of gorton's inc. apr 05 2024 best if used by air fried gorton's tests to ensure strict compliance with both gorton's and government quality and safety standards, including those for mercury.
